[DhakaTribune] Abdul Latif, a 48-year-old shopkeeper from Lakshmipur district, is in critical condition at Dhaka Medical College and Hospital (DMCH) after being brutally attacked by Chhatra League and Jubo League activists.

The attack occurred during a celebratory procession following the ousting of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ina.

Latif, the sole provider for his family, was severely injured on August 6 in Bhuiyan Haat, Char Ramich Union, Ramgati upazila.

As he participated in the procession, he was targeted by a group from Chhatra League and Jubo League, who attacked him with machetes, sticks, and rods, causing severe injuries including a large wound in his abdomen.

His intestines were exposed due to the continuous assault.

Local residents who witnessed the attack helped to stabilize Latif's injuries with a cloth before he was rushed to a nearby Sadar hospital.

Due to the severity of his injuries, he was referred to DMCH and admitted at 11pm on the same day.

He underwent a lengthy surgery from 12:30am to 5:30am on August 7.

Latif's wife, Bibi Asiya, expressed her anguish, stating that the family is struggling to cope with the financial strain caused by her husband's inability to work. With Latif unable to walk and an uncertain recovery timeline, the family faces severe hardship. Their home in Lakshmipur has also been flooded, adding to their difficulties.

16 Afghan troops killed as forces repulse cross-border attack
[DailyTimesPakistain] Afghan Taliban

US army says four ISIS ‘leaders’ killed during a recent raid in Iraq UPDATE: Big Turban Abu Ali Al-Tunisi had US$5mil head money
[Rudaw] The US army announced on Saturday that four suspected Islamic State

(ISIS) leaders were killed in a recent joint raid with the Iraqi security forces in western Iraq, including one responsible for the group’s all operations in the country.

The joint raid took place in Anbar province on August 29. US and Iraqi armies have provided conflicting numbers about ISIS corpse count, with the US Central Command (CENTCOM) initially putting the number at 15 and now it says 14 were killed. Iraq initially said 14 were killed but later said the number had increased to 16.

The US army said that four of them were ISIS leaders responsible for the group's operations and technical development in Iraq.

"As part of the on-going post-raid assessment, CENTCOM can confirm that four ISIS leaders were killed including: Ahmad Hamid Husayn Abd-al-Jalil al-Ithawi, responsible for all operations in Iraq, Abu Hammam, responsible for overseeing all operations in Western Iraq, Abu-’Ali al-Tunisi, responsible for overseeing technical development, and Shakir Abud Ahmad al-Issawi, responsible for overseeing military operations in Western Iraq," said CENTCOM in a statement.

"This operation targeted ISIS leaders and served to disrupt and degrade ISIS’ ability to plan, organize, and conduct attacks against Iraqi civilians, as well as U.S. citizens, allies, and partners throughout the region and beyond," it added.

The operation was centered around Anbar province’s Wadi al-Ghadaf, described by the Iraqi military as an "important den" for ISIS remnants in the country.

Seven US personnel were maimed in the operation.

Iraqi and US forces kill top ISIS commander in joint operation

US Treasury had offered $5 million for info on Abu Ali Al-Tunisi; several other prominent members of terror group killed; troops seized weapons, computers, phones,10 explosive belts

Iraqi forces and American troops have killed a senior commander with the Islamic State group who was wanted by the United States, as well as several other prominent militants, Iraq’s military said on Friday.

The operation in Iraq’s western Anbar province began in late August, the Iraqi military said, and also involved members of the Iraqi National Intelligence Service and Iraq’s air force.

Among the dead was an ISIS commander from Tunisia, known as Abu Ali Al-Tunisi, for whom the US Treasury Department had offered $5 million for information. Also killed was Ahmad Hamed Zwein, the IS deputy commander in Iraq.

Despite their defeat, attacks by ISIS sleeper cells in Iraq and Syria have been on the rise over the past years, with scores of people killed or wounded.

Friday’s announcement was not the first news of the operation.

Two weeks ago, an official said that the United States military and Iraq launched a joint raid targeting suspected ISIS militants in the country’s western desert that killed at least 15 people and left seven American troops hurt.

Five of the American troops were wounded in the raid itself, while two others suffered injuries from falls during the operation. One who suffered a fall was transported out of the region, while one of the wounded was evacuated for further treatment, a US defense official said at the time, speaking on condition of anonymity to discuss details of the operation that had not yet been made public.

In Friday’s announcement, the Iraqi military said the operation also confiscated weapons and computers, smart phones and 10 explosive belts. It added that 14 ISIS commanders were identified after DNA tests were conducted. It made no mention of the 15th person killed and whether that person had also been identified.

IDF finds under-construction tunnel in West Bank’s Tulkarem
[IsraelTimes] Tunnels are rare in the region, where the Israeli army operates regularly to dismantle terror infrastructure

The Israel Defense Forces said Friday it had located a short underground tunnel near a hospital in the West Bank city of Tulkarem amid an ongoing counter-terrorism operation.

The tunnel had an entrance but no exit, the military said, indicating that it was still under construction.

The IDF said troops would investigate the tunnel and then destroy it.

IDF: UNRWA staffer killed in West Bank raid was hurling explosives at troops
[IsraelTimes] Army accuses Sufyan Jaber Abed Jawwad of being a known terror operative in the Fara’a camp, after the UN agency says he was ‘shot and killed on the roof of his home by a sniper’

The UN agency for Paleostinian refugees said Friday that one of its employees was killed this week during an Israeli raid in the West Bank.

UNRWA identified the slain employee as Sufyan Jaber Abed Jawwad, who "worked as a sanitation laborer" in the northern West Bank’s Fara’a camp and "is survived by his wife and five children."

According to UNRWA, he was "shot and killed on the roof of his home by a sniper" and that it was "the first time an UNRWA staff member has been killed in the West Bank in more than 10 years."

The Israel Defense Forces later said Jawwad was throwing explosives at troops in the camp and was a known terror operative, issuing an English language statement accusing the agency of "not telling the full story."

IDF spokesperson Nadav Shoshani said that during an operation in Fara’a, a suspect was identified hurling bombs that posed a threat to the forces operating in the area. IDF troops opened fire toward him to remove said threat, and he was killed.

"The terrorist was subsequently identified and it was discovered he is also an UNRWA employee named Sufyan Jaber Abed Jawwad. It should be noted that after receiving his details, it was found that the terrorist was known to Israeli security forces and he had been complicit in additional terrorist activities," Shoshani said.

"This is yet another example of an UNRWA employee taking active part in terrorist activities against Israel, as has been proven in several other cases in the past, including employees who participated in the October 7 massacre," he said.

Three killed in Baluchi militants attack in southwest Iran
[Rudaw] At least three Iranian border guards were killed after an attack by a Sunni bad boy group in Sistan and Baluchestan province, southwest of Iran, on Thursday evening.

Mehdi Shamsabadi, Sistan and Baluchestan prosecutor, told news hounds that a group of person or persons unknown targeted the border guards while they were filling gas at a station in Mirjaveh city. Three border guards were killed and one civilian was injured.

In separate conversations with Interior Minister Eskandar Momeni and Sistan and Baluchestan Governor Mohammad Karami, Iranian Vice President Mohammad Reza Aref "emphasized the necessity of preventing the recurrence of such terrorist incidents by strengthening the borders of the country," according to the semi-official Mehr News Agency

Jaish al-Adl, a Sunni bad boy group which frequently targets Iranian security forces in Sistan and Baluchestan, grabbed credit for the attack in a statement, warning that the province "is not safe for the guards of the oppressive regime."
Added for future reference: Jaish al-Adl, sometimes spelt Jaysh al-Adl, is an indigenous Balochi Salafi insurgent group based in Pakistan’s Baloch province. They regularly cross the border to attack Iranian targets. For some reason, the Iranian news media sometimes refer to the group as Jaish ul-Zalm.
Sistan and Baluchestan province, near the Pak border, is one of the only Sunni-majority provinces in the Shiite-dominated Iran. There are a number of Baluchi gangs active in the area that carry out regular bombings and suicide kabooms.

Jaish al-Adl, has carried out a number of suicide attacks on Iranian security forces, killing dozens in the border areas. The group was added to the list of Foreign Terrorist Organizations in 2019 by the administration of former US President Donald Trump

Hezbollah drone hits Galilee after overnight barrage on Safed sparked forest fire
[IsraelTimes] IDF says majority of projectiles intercepted, remainder fell in open areas; Iran-backed terror group claims attack was revenge for Israeli strike in southern Lebanon a day earlier

The Hezbollah terror group fired some 20 rockets toward the northern city of Safed early Friday morning, sparking a large blaze in a nearby forest and causing minor damage to a building in another community, authorities said.

No injuries were reported in the attack claimed by the Lebanese group, which said it had targeted a military installation in Dire Revenge for a deadly strike in southern Leb

The Israel Defense Forces said some 20 rockets were fired toward Safed at around 1 a.m., setting off alarms in the city and surrounding Upper Galilee towns.

The majority of rockets were intercepted, the IDF said in a statement, and the remainder fell in uninhabited areas.

Sirens in nearby areas were activated over fears of falling shrapnel from Iron Dome interceptor missiles.

No injuries were reported in the early morning barrage, the IDF said. However,
a hangover is the wrath of grapes...
the rocket fire sparked a blaze in the Birya Forest, north of Safed, according to authorities.

Firefighting crews were dispatched to the scene and eventually managed to get the blaze under control, the Israel Fire and Rescue Services said shortly before 7 a.m.

A rocket fragment also caused minor damage to a building in the nearby community of Dalton, the Kan public broadcaster said, publishing a photo of a small hole punched through a structure.

Safed lies some 13 kilometers (eight miles) from the border with Lebanon, and unlike many communities nearer the frontier, the city of some 38,000 remains largely inhabited, with attacks that deep into Israel relatively uncommon.

In its statement claiming the attack, Hezbollah said that it had launched the barrage as Dire Revenge for what it said was an Israeli strike in the village of Kfarjouz on Thursday. The Iran-backed group claimed to have targeted a key air defense site north of Safed.

Sirens again sounded in Safed and nearby communities on Friday, warning of a drone attack. Footage posted to social media showed a Hezbollah drone flying over the area.

The IDF said the drone launched impacted an unspecified area in the Upper Galilee. "The target did not fall in any towns in the area," the military clarified.

Separately, two rockets were launched from Lebanon at the Misgav Am area on Friday. Both were intercepted by air defenses, the IDF said. Another rocket launched from Lebanon at Snir struck an open area. No injuries were caused in the attacks.

The last several days have seen cross-border fire appear to intensify somewhat, with Hezbollah launching around 100 rockets into Israel on Wednesday and dozens more on Thursday.

The Lebanese health ministry said on Thursday that three people were killed and three others injured in a strike on the village, located some 10 kilometers from the border with Israel. Speaking to AFP, a source close to Hezbollah confirmed that at least one of those killed was a member of the Iran-backed terror group.

Lebanon’s state-run National News Agency said the strike "targeted two cycle of violences on the Nabatieh-Kfarjouz road," adding that a passing car was also hit.

The Lebanese health ministry said an "Israeli enemy strike" hit the village of Kfarjouz near Nabatieh, around 10 kilometers (six miles) from the border with Israel.

The IDF said it struck several Hezbollah sites in southern Lebanon over the course of Thursday, including buildings in Aitaroun, Marimin, Chihne and Maroum al-Ras. It also said it destroyed rocket launchers in Zibquin and Majdal Zoun, including one used in previous attacks on Israel.

Since October 8, Hezbollah-led forces have attacked Israeli communities and military posts along the border on a near-daily basis. Hezbollah has named 438 members who have been killed by Israel during the ongoing skirmishes, mostly in Lebanon but some also in Syria. Another 78 operatives from other terror groups, a Lebanese soldier, and dozens of civilians have also been killed.
